4,295,020,928 (four billion two hundred ninety-five million twenty thousand nine hundred twenty-eight) is an even 10-digit number. It is a composite number with 128 divisors, and factors as 2⁷ × 11 × 41 × 47 × 1,583. Its proper divisors sum to 5,476,611,712,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0x10000D180.
